Step‑by‑Step Instructions for Chocolate Fudge Cake
Step 1: Preheat the Oven
Begin by preheating your oven to 350°F (175°C). This step is essential for ensuring your Chocolate Fudge Cake bakes evenly. While the oven heats up, gather your ingredients and have a 9-inch round cake pan ready, greased and prepared for the batter.
Step 2: Combine Dry Ingredients
In a large mixing bowl, sift together the unsweetened cocoa powder, all-purpose flour, granulated sugar, baking powder, and salt. Whisk these dry ingredients until well-combined, ensuring there are no lumps, as this will help create a smooth batter for your fudgy cake. Set this mixture aside for the next step.
Step 3: Mix Wet Ingredients
In a separate bowl, beat together the softened unsalted butter and eggs until creamy and combined. Add in the vanilla extract and mix until incorporated. This wet mixture adds richness and moisture to your Chocolate Fudge Cake, creating that signature fudgy texture everyone loves.
Step 4: Combine Wet and Dry Mixtures
Gradually add the wet ingredient mixture to the dry mixture, stirring continuously to combine. Slowly pour in the boiling water, mixing until the batter is smooth and well-blended. This water helps activate the cocoa powder, making your cake unbelievably moist and decadent.
Step 5: Pour Batter into Pan
Carefully pour the silky batter into your prepared cake pan, ensuring an even distribution. Use a spatula to smooth the top, which will help your Chocolate Fudge Cake rise evenly and create a beautifully baked finish.
Step 6: Bake the Cake
Place the filled cake pan in your preheated oven and bake for 30 to 35 minutes. Keep an eye out for doneness by inserting a toothpick into the center; if it comes out clean or with a few crumbs, your cake is ready to come out.
Step 7: Cool the Cake
Once baked, remove the Chocolate Fudge Cake from the oven and let it cool in the pan for 10 minutes. After this cooling period, gently run a knife around the edges and turn the cake out onto a wire rack. Allow it to cool completely before decorating or serving.

How to Store and Freeze Chocolate Fudge Cake
Room Temperature: Store leftover chocolate fudge cake in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 3 days to maintain its rich texture.
Fridge: For extended freshness, refrigerate the cake in an airtight container for up to 5 days. Bring it to room temperature before serving for the best flavor.
Freezer: Wrap individual slices tightly in plastic wrap and then in aluminum foil to freeze. They can last for up to 3 months, allowing you to enjoy this decadent treat anytime!
Reheating: When ready to indulge, gently reheat slices in the microwave for 10-15 seconds, or use the oven at 350°F (175°C) for about 5 minutes to restore moisture.

Expert Tips for the Best Chocolate Fudge Cake
- Room Temperature Ingredients: Ensure all ingredients are at room temperature before starting to help create a smooth batter and even bake.
- Measure Carefully: Use a kitchen scale for precise ingredient measurements, especially flour and cocoa powder. Too much can lead to a dense cake.
- Avoid Over-Mixing: Gently combine wet and dry ingredients to prevent over-mixing, which can cause the cake to become tough instead of light and fudgy.
- Cooling Time: Allow the cake to cool completely before frosting or serving to prevent melting your toppings and maintain the perfect slice.

Chocolate Fudge Cake Variations & Substitutions
Ready to put your personal touch on this delightful cake? Let your creativity shine as you experiment with flavors and textures!
- Gluten-Free: Use a gluten-free flour blend with xanthan gum to maintain that perfect tender crumb.
- Nutty Crunch: Fold in a half cup of chopped walnuts or pecans for a delightful crunch that complements the fudgy texture.
- Choco-Mint Twist: Add a teaspoon of peppermint extract to the batter for a refreshing minty flavor that feels like a cozy holiday treat.
- Espresso Boost: Incorporate a tablespoon of espresso powder into the dry ingredients to intensify the chocolate flavor without adding extra moisture.
- Zesty Delight: Mix in the zest of one orange to the batter for a bright, fruity contrast that’ll surprise your taste buds.
- Vegan Option: Swap the eggs with flaxseed meal (1 tablespoon of flaxseed mixed with 2.5 tablespoons of water) and use coconut oil in place of butter for a vegan twist.
- Decadent Ganache: Top with a rich chocolate ganache for an indulgent finish; just melt chocolate with heavy cream and pour it over the cooled cake.
- Spicy Kick: Add a dash of cayenne pepper or cinnamon to the batter for a surprising heat that beautifully balances the sweet fudge.

What should I do if my cake sinks in the middle?
If your cake sinks in the middle, it might be due to over-mixing the batter or opening the oven door too soon. To prevent sinking, ensure that your ingredients are mixed just until combined and try to keep the oven door closed during baking to maintain an even temperature.
